William Kloefkorn, Nebraska

William Kloefkorn lives and writes in Lincoln, where he is emeritus professor of English at Nebraska Wesleyan. He¹s the author of 12 books of poetry, including Covenants, a book he wrote with Utah¹s poet laureate, David Lee. He¹s also written two collections of short stories, a memoir, and a collection of children's Christmas stories. He initiated the Nebraska “poets in the schools” program, and has read his work and conducted workshops in elementary, junior high, and high schools in Nebraska and across the country. He's received several awards for his work, and his writing appears in numerous periodicals and anthologies.

Appointment: 1982
